What actually makes an apartment work for a long stay

A hotel room and a long stay apartment look similar on a booking site. They're not the same thing once you're living out of one for a few weeks. The difference comes down to a handful of things:

  • An equipped kitchenette, so you're not eating out or ordering in every night

  • Proper laundry facilities, not a bag sent out for a fee

  • Separate living and sleeping space, so there's somewhere to unwind that isn't your bed

  • Weekly or extended-stay rates that beat a nightly hotel rate over time

  • Parking, since a longer stay usually means a car

What to check before booking any long stay apartment

Not every "long stay" listing means the same thing. Before booking anywhere, it's worth checking:

  • Minimum stay requirements for weekly and extended rates to apply

  • What's actually in the kitchen — a stovetop and microwave is a very different thing from a full kitchen with an oven and dishwasher

  • Whether parking is included or extra

  • Cleaning frequency, since daily housekeeping isn't always included, or wanted, on a longer booking
